Week 5, October 7th – Fall Trail Kids 2024

Another magical week kicked off today at Bike School Bentonville.  Although it was way hotter than it should have been, the Trail Kids showed up in force today.  Many coaches took today as an opportunity to push the limits of their group, and it was amazing.  As everyone rolled out from the trailer, crews practiced their shifting and body position skills on the rolling terrain of All American.  

After cruising through All American, several coaches led their groups to the right up the newly cleared Black Apple Creek trail, while others continued on to the climb towards Leopards Loop and Choo Choo to work on their berms and their pumping on the smooth yet turny chip sealed trails.

As I followed groups through Black Apple Creek, stoke was high as they continued on towards Red Barn and Tristan's trail.  It was seriously impressive to see so many riders working hard to get to the top of those climbs because just a few weeks before shifting and climbing were extremely difficult for many of the Trail Kids.

After finally cruising down Tristans in a smattering of different combinations, the Trail Kids returned from one of the longest and most challenging rides of their Trail Kids Careers. 

Wednesday was a special day because for the first time this season, every single group of Trail Kids arrived at the Castle simultaneously.  Watching groups prove their climbing and shifting skills on the challenging castle climb, and then turn around to start descending all the different trails that stem from the castle was amazing.
